Join Oracle’s cloud infrastructure organization at the forefront of global cloud expansion. As a Program Manager, you will lead the end-to-end delivery of complex cloud build programs in highly regulated, security-sensitive, and isolated environments. This role is responsible for coordinating large, cross-functional initiatives across planning, design, construction, deployment, validation, security hardening, accreditation readiness, and operational handoff.
You will operate in environments where standard delivery processes must be combined with careful issue resolution, customer-specific requirements, and the development of repeatable delivery methods for future programs. The role includes close coordination across engineering, operations, security, compliance, supply chain, networking, service readiness, facilities, and customer stakeholders to bring new cloud environments online safely, efficiently, and at scale.

Qualifications
- Strategic Program Leadership: Proven ability to develop, drive, and execute complex, large-scale infrastructure or operational programs aligned to business objectives. Experienced in translating strategic goals into actionable plans with clear ownership, milestones, dependencies, and delivery criteria.
- Operational Delivery in Regulated Environments: Demonstrated experience managing programs with elevated security, compliance, or customer-specific constraints. Able to balance standardization with exception handling and convert one-time challenges into durable process improvements.
- Infrastructure and Build Readiness: Experience coordinating data center, hardware, networking, supply chain, logistics, and site readiness activities. Comfortable managing ordering dependencies, design approvals, lead times, facility readiness, and vendor coordination.
- Technical Acumen: Solid understanding of cloud infrastructure, service dependencies, deployment workflows, operational support models, and secure environment constraints. Experience managing programs in cloud services or related technical domains is strongly preferred.
- Analytical and Data-Driven: Strong analytical skills with experience tracking milestones, readiness signals, capacity assumptions, operational constraints, and program performance to guide decision-making and continuous improvement.
- Collaboration and Communication: Exceptional written and verbal communication skills. Proven ability to align engineering, operations, supply chain, compliance, security, and business stakeholders around shared plans and decisions.
- Execution Under Ambiguity: Strong problem-solving skills in environments where processes, policies, or technical approaches may still be maturing. Comfortable identifying gaps, driving decisions, and formalizing new workflows as programs evolve.
Responsibilities
- End-to-End Program Delivery: Lead the program management of complex cloud expansion initiatives across the full lifecycle, from early planning and design through construction, deployment, validation, security hardening, accreditation readiness, and operational handoff. Manage stage-gate readiness, key dependencies, and execution risk throughout.
- Planning and Design Coordination: Drive workstreams for site planning, operations readiness, migration planning, service readiness, and facility design. Ensure requirements are translated into executable plans, approved baselines, and clear decision records.
- Procurement and Ordering Management: Coordinate standard ordering procedures across materials planning, design approvals, vendor alignment, lead-time tracking, logistics planning, and delivery readiness. Partner with engineering, supply chain, and build teams to ensure infrastructure and hardware arrive on time and in the required configuration.
- Deployment and Readiness Management: Orchestrate prerequisites for deployment, including access planning, service dependencies, environment readiness, validation sequencing, and operational control points. Work across technical and operational teams to prepare secure environments for launch and steady-state operations.
- Security and Compliance Integration: Coordinate security- and compliance-driven workstreams such as restricted-access operating models, environment hardening, secure transfer processes, artifact handling, support model readiness, and customer accreditation dependencies. Ensure delivery plans remain supportable within contractual and regulatory boundaries.
- Cross-Functional Issue Resolution: Identify risks, blockers, and one-off issues early, then drive structured resolution across teams. Convert lessons learned into reusable standards, templates, and knowledge resources that improve future delivery programs.
- Operational Transition Planning: Ensure each environment is ready for steady-state operations by coordinating support ownership, monitoring expectations, runbooks, staffing dependencies, and handoffs across technical, operational, and customer teams.
- Stakeholder and Customer Engagement: Serve as a central program lead across internal leadership, engineering, operations, external vendors, and customer stakeholders. Maintain alignment on scope, schedule, risks, assumptions, and decision timelines throughout the program lifecycle.
- Continuous Improvement: Help mature delivery playbooks for secure and highly regulated cloud environments by identifying recurring patterns, improving governance, and defining standard work for future builds.
